Grayish Dark Blue

The color #333E49 is a grayish dark blue that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 51, 62, 73 and HSL values of 210°, 18%, 24%.

Complementary Colors for #333E49

The complementary color for #333E49 is #483D32.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#333E49

The analogous colors for #333E49 are #324848 and #323248.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#333E49

The triadic colors for #333E49 are #48323D and #3D4832.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
